BPA Free! Grow Healthy. Grow Happy, Makes Big Bites Small, Cut Noodles, Veggies, and More! At Green Sprouts we know you want the best for your baby. That’s why we make baby-friendly products for your little one to grow healthy and grow happy, Green Sprouts products meet FDA, CPSIA and ASTM F963 safety standards for the US, Stainless Steel cutting edge makes bug bites small, Cut noodles, veggies, and more! Make sure your baby is sitting upright in her chair, offer her manageable servings, and be sure to learn the difference between gagging and choking: A child who is choking will look terrified, will not be making any sounds, and will be unable to breathe, whereas a baby who has experienced a gag reflex will be coughing and making sounds. In canada sodium content in infant food is regulated; strained fruit, fruit juice, fruit drink, and cereal cannot be sold if sodium has been added (Excluding strained desserts). 1,2 As infants gain fine motor control, they progress from being fed exclusively by others to at least partial self-feeding. In a nutshell, baby-led weaning simply means that you bypass the spoon-feeding-of-purees stage and allow your baby to self-feed finger foods as his motor skills allow him. Problems associated with eating occur in 25% to 45% of all children, particularly when children are acquiring new skills and are challenged with new foods or mealtime expectations. Research shows that pressuring to eat results in less food intake while cutting a child off at mealtime increases the likelihood they will eat in the absence of hunger (Think sneaking and eating more when able).
